"Six Major Prophets" by Edwin E. Slosson is a profound exploration of the lives and teachings of six influential prophets who have shaped religious thought and practice throughout history. Slosson delves into the historical context and the spiritual messages of these figures, providing readers with insights into their significance and the impact they have had on various cultures. The book serves as both a biographical account and a theological examination, making it accessible to both scholars and general readers interested in the intersection of history and spirituality. *** In this work, Slosson emphasizes the universal themes found in the teachings of these prophets, highlighting their contributions to moral philosophy and ethical living. Each chapter is dedicated to a different prophet, offering a detailed analysis of their teachings and the societal challenges they faced. By weaving together historical narratives and philosophical reflections, Slosson invites readers to reflect on the relevance of these ancient messages in contemporary society. The book ultimately encourages a deeper understanding of faith and its role in human experience.
